Q-Games released some welcome news for those of you eagerly anticipating PixelJunk Shooter 2, as well as those who don't know whether or not they should be eagerly anticipating it. The sequel to the PSN shooter is "full steam ahead, anchors away and all that ... commotion to that order," Q-Games president Dylan Cuthbert said in a PlayStation Blog post. He promised that not only will Shooter 2 be larger than the original game, but that "it will have some features that are new to the PixelJunk series in general."

If you are not intrigued about the sequel simply because you haven't experienced Shooter, Q-Games has something for you too. On May 25, Cuthbert said, a demo of the original PixelJunk Shooter will be released on the PlayStation Network. If you like that, you can buy PixelJunk Shooter, like it, and then join us all in waiting for 2.

Modified version of the Music PRX, plugin that allows us to hear our songs stored on the Memory Stick or UMD all games up for the occasion executable suitable for use on the new custom firmware revision Jan upto 5:50 D3.
The controls are the same as the classic version, is installed as a normal prx and weighs a few kb, also worth remembering that among the functions is also a convenient shortcut to toggle the audio of the game running, so to hear the songs without the sound effects even at high volume.
To follow the link to download.

Controls:

Quote:

SELECT + square: Shows the menu

SELECT + Circle: reset all settings

SELECT + triangle increases the CPU clock

SELECT + cross: it decreases the CPU clock

SELECT + to: raise the volume

SELECT + Down: Volume Down

SELECT + Left / Right: changes track

SELECT + home: turn off the audio of the game running

SELECT + start: Enable the repetition

SELECT + L: pause / resume playback

SELECT + R toggles shuffle

Almost four months since the last release, an update is available for CTFtool GUI application designed by the developer patpat PC, allowing you to create themes for the CXMB PSP-compatible addition to allowing the extraction of files from format issues. Ctf ready. This new release, although it is still in beta, introduces new features and fixes some bugs in previous versions.
Following the full changelog and download link.

Changelog v4 Beta 5.9:

Quote:

Note: The following files were removed from the archive:
- 5:50 Folder: game_plugin.prx, game_plugin.rco, msvideo_main_plugin.rco, music_main_plugin.prx, paf.prx, visualizer_plugin.prx, vshmain.prx, common_gui.prx
- Folder basis (3.71 - 4.01): common_gui.prx, vshmain.prx, paf.prx
- Base Folder 5.00: common_gui.prx, vshmain.prx, paf.prx, msvideo_main_plugin.rco

These files have been removed because, for a variety of domestic politics PSP-ITA, are not allowed to post on the forum.
To find them, you must use the PSARDumper and extract them from their firmware.

Changelog v4 Beta 5.9
- Added Windows Explorer context menu support for RCO | PRX | CTF | PTF | PMF | MPS | TTF | PGF | VAG | WAV | GMO | GMO | GIM | TGA | BMP | PNG | JPG | GIF | ICO | PSD | BIN | GZ | ZL file format right-click menu
- Join the PGF, gim, vag, omg, gmo, mps, zl file type association, direct double-click to open
- Added image processing functions, support GIM | TGA | BMP | PNG | JPG | GIF | ICO | PSD format for the rapid conversion, reset the resolution, indexed color
- Join OMG wave model image extraction / Import module
- Added random picture QUICKLY generated / replace omg wave pattern (wave patterns Have Been ball, boot style wave, wave tilt style, classic style wave)
- Added vag / wav audio Mutual Convert function
- Added mps / pmf Mutual Convert video function
- Added ttf / font PGF Mutual Convert function
- Floating-point value added prx extract / Import function
- Added rco function of conventional resource extraction
- Added boot sound extract / Import function
- Added PGF font information extraction capabilities
- Added PTF package features (CBC special, picture format open only over the two pictures into a folder you can right-fast packaging. Recommend the picture to pi, bp, bg, 01,02,03 or open name, Corresponding preview icon, preview maps, wallpapers)
- Added 01-12.bmp/13-27.bmp pack / unpack functionality (picture format not limited to one or more into the folder with the right to QUICKLY pack)
- Automatically Theme pack in the 01-12.bmp Amendment vshmain.prx the size of the function parameters
- Added theme pack psp Automatically sent to the function and Automatically Detect Whether the installed plug-ins and open CXMB
- Added gzip compression / decompression
- Added zlib compression / decompression
- Fixed 500 rpm led 550 rooms, networking crash bugs
- Added tray bubble tips
- Optimized code to Improve processing speed
- Fixed CTF-extracting file records HAVING empty bug Caused decompression failure

Videogame revenue was down across the board in April 2010, compared to the same time last year. While the factors contributing to the decline are many, it would appear the handheld segment of the market was the real culprit.

“The portable side of the industry contributed more than its fair share to the industry decline,” according to NPD analyst Anita Frazier. “The portable business across hardware, software and accessories accounted for 25% of total industry dollar sales in April but declines in portable sales compared to April ‘09 accounted for 61% of the total industry decrease”.

In April 2009, the Nintendo DS sold over a million units of hardware. In April 2010, of all the platforms that declined compared to last year, the DS accounts for 71% of the overall hardware decline. Meanwhile, the PSP suffered an equally great drop in hardware sales, down from 116K units in April ‘09 to 65.5K units in 2010.

An important point to note here, however, is that the NPD group don’t track iPhone and iPad sales in their report, both of which certainly count as portable platforms for gaming.

Hakuouki Yuugi Roku is a peek into the daily lives of the shinsengumi members, play mini games with them and see their not-so-serious sides. Each member is in charge of a chore, clothes washing, tea-making and daily training. Go help them out and know more about them.

See the regular proportioned swordsmen in the adventure part and do daily chores with them in the mini game parts. During the mini games, all the swordsman will be chibi-fied, come see their cute sides and gush.
